Frequently Asked Questions about Creek Senter
How much are Studio apartments in Creek Senter?
There are currently 33 Studio Apartments in Creek Senter with rent ranges from $1,975 to $2,470 with an average price of $2,210.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Creek Senter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Creek Senter ranges from $1,100 to $5,540 with an average monthly rent of $2,734.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Creek Senter c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Creek Senter range from $2,400 to $6,111.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,300.
How expensive are Creek Senter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 51 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Creek Senter on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$3,580 to $4,099 - averaging $3,796 for the location.
